Helium Summary: The Polaris Dawn mission launched on September 10, 2024, led by billionaire Jared Isaacman, marking a significant step in private space exploration with plans for the first commercially funded human spacewalk.

The crew aims to reach unprecedented altitudes of 1,400 kilometers, surpassing the Apollo missions' heights.

As they navigate hazardous radiation belts, they will gather crucial data for deep-space missions, testing new medical approaches and technologies for health monitoring.

This mission reflects SpaceX's evolving role in shaping civilian space exploration beyond governmental frameworks, aligning with Elon Musk's ambitions for colonizing Mars .

Commercial Space Exploration Potential


The Polaris Dawn mission showcases the growing trend of commercial space ventures. By funding and operating private missions, SpaceX is positioning itself as a leader in human spaceflight beyond government oversight. Experts suggest such missions bring essential data critical for future interplanetary travel, especially concerning human health and safety .

Skepticism Towards Space Tourism


While some view the mission as innovative, others express skepticism, labeling the private spacewalk as a 'gimmick' that overshadows its scientific potential. Critics argue that it might prioritize spectacle over meaningful research, suggesting that emotional markers may distract from the technical and health-related insights crucial for safe space exploration .
